One of the most transformative trends in civil aviation is the adoption of comprehensive data analytics platforms that enable proactive safety measures. Airlines and regulatory agencies are increasingly leveraging big data to identify risk patterns, predict potential failures, and implement preventative actions. This shift not only allows for real-time monitoring but also fosters a culture of continuous improvement rooted in empirical evidence.
For instance, the International Civil Aviation Organization (ICAO) has been instrumental in promoting safety management systems (SMS) that embed data analysis into daily operations. These systems can analyze thousands of parameters—from flight data recorder information to maintenance logs—to pinpoint vulnerabilities before they translate into incidents.

A hallmark of aviation safety sophistication is the establishment of international standards and certification processes. Agencies like the European Union Aviation Safety Agency (EASA) and the Federal Aviation Administration (FAA) rigorously vet aircraft components and operational procedures. Collaborations across nations foster the sharing of best practices and rapid dissemination of safety innovations.
